Transaction 90665f2cd866d597093cc5b970383ec220e77dd4d8e50368035725432502a5cc
1 Input
2 Outputs
- 90665f2cd866d597093cc5b970383ec220e77dd4d8e50368035725432502a5cc:0
- 90665f2cd866d597093cc5b970383ec220e77dd4d8e50368035725432502a5cc:1
value 31315923
address 37SpUD2vB3gD3NZo68sLqEBbbfyP9HWoZe
value 424286483
address 14zV5ZCqYmgyCzoVEhRVsP7SpUDVsCBz5g